French

Etymology

From Medieval Latin stigmatizō, from Byzantine Greek στιγματίζω (stigmatízō). By surface analysis, stigmate +‎ -iser.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/stiɡ.ma.ti.ze/
  • Audio (France (Lyon)):(file)
  • Audio (France (Somain)):(file)

Verb

stigmatiser

  1. (transitive, historical) to stigmatize (to mark with a permanent identity mark branded, cut or tattooed onto the skin)
    On stigmatisait autrefois les esclaves fugitifs.
    (please add an English translation of this usage example)
  2. (transitive) to blame, to criticize
    M. de Faverges stigmatisa ces œuvres où l'on bafoue les choses les plus saintes, la famille, la propriété, le mariage ! (Flaubert, Bouvard et Pécuchet, t. 2, 1880)
